City Opens Funding Applications for 2026 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. Day Events

The City of Boulder will open Human Relations Fund(HRF) rolling applications for 2026 Martin Luther King Jr. Day events today, Monday, Nov. 3, 2025.

Beginning in 2026, HRF support will focus only on community-initiated events associated with Martin Luther King Jr. Day, Juneteenth, Immigrant Heritage Month and Indigenous Peoples Day, that raise awareness of civil rights, human rights, or equity issues and problems in Boulder; facilitate interaction, understanding, collaboration and civic participation among diverse communities; and enable communities that experience marginalization to celebrate events significant to them while providing learning opportunities to the general population.

Applications for this fund round will close on Wednesday, December 3, 2025, at 4:00 p.m. Both English and Spanish applications are available.
